摘 要:探讨在小样织机上织造纱罗织物的方法。简要回顾了纱罗织物的历史。介绍了线制绞综的制作方法和在小样织机上的使用方法。结合纱罗织物线描图和上机图,通过控制后综、基综、地综的数量及穿法,完成了从简单到复杂的多种纱罗织物织造。实践表明:纱线的粗细、刚性会对绞转的稳定度、绞转效果及孔隙大小产生影响;借助空筘穿法可以有效控制纱罗的孔隙度;织造复杂纱罗时,绞经和地经分轴整经有利于经纱张力均匀,绞转效果明显。认为:通过相关改造,可以在小样织机上开发纱罗织物。Method of weaving leno fabric on sample loom was discussed.History of leno fabric was briefly reviewed.Method of making stranded leno heddle and method of using it on sample loom were introduced.Combining line drawing and threading chart of leno fabric,through controlling the number of rear heddle,base heddle and ground heddle and heddle draft method,a variety of leno fabric weaving from simple to complex were completed.The practice showed that the thickness and rigidity of the yarn affected stability of coils,the effect of coils and size of pores.Porosity of leno fabric could be effectively controlled with the help of hollow reeding method.When weaving complex leno fabric,section beam was adopted for split thread and ground warp,which was beneficial to even warp tension,effect coils was obvious.It is considered that leno fabric can be developed on sample loom through related modification.
